I became interested in getting a chameleon in Sept of this year. I did several weeks of reading between here and chameleonforums.com after seeing that site mentioned to another member. I am so glad I found that site! They have been a wonderful resource and that is where I was recommended to check with Matt (aka Matt Vanilla Gorilla there) on availability.

I contacted him via pm on 10-3 and was given his number to text for more information. We spoke 10-4 via txt about his availability and the fact my time frame for actually wanting to purchase wouldn't be until towards the end of Oct. I had checked here on the boi but came up empty on searching his name which did make me a little nervous at first. But, he came highly recommended on cf and the more we talked the more I understood why.

Matt and his family truly care about the chameleons they sell and the customers they deal with. Despite knowing I was not really going be ready until the end of October Matt continued our initial conversation unlike what encountered when I inquired with ours. He showed me a male and female nosy be he had available. My wife and I fell in love with male and me with the female. We decided to just go with the male since the female is his sibling and Matt was very understanding.

Since I wasn't going to be ready until the end of October but we wanted the male dearly I nervously approached him about a deal to go ahead and make the purchase but Matt hold him until I was ready for him to ship. He had no problem with doing that for me and we had a deal. As I set about drawing up my cage plans I bounced ideas of Matt and changes were made here and there and all the while we talked daily. So much so that I've come to consider him a friend, not just a breeder that my beautiful new chameleon came from. I don't know how they do it but some how him and his family manage to work normal jobs/ go to school, keep up with their chameleons and talk day and night with customers.

Over the last month I've received picture and video updates of our baby boy. I thought I had been downloading the pics as they were viewed but sadly I wasn't. Matt was kind enough to resend the original pics along with a bunch going back when he was a baby still showing his greens and grays. Matt has gone above and beyond what anyone could reasonably expect a breeder to do in helping me does my best to make sure it would be as smooth of a transition for blue lightning as possible. He has arrived in excellent health and extremely active. I can't begin to explain how happy my wife and I are with our new baby boy. So, I felt Matt was due to have good guy posting here in case anyone like myself searches in the future. I'm currently waiting on his next clutch to hatch in Jan/ Feb so I can hopefully get my unrelated female from him and his family middle of next year :hehe:.
